The grave of Prophet Muhammad happens to be inside a sealed shrine encompassed by two intertwined walls. It has no house, and it’s also impossible to go into. Nowadays, we don’t have a picture of this grave. As reported by the old origins, actually a grave with stones lined up and would be amassed with environment. Eventhough it is relatively curled when it is first made, it flattened in the long run.

The most important shrine built-in Islamic history could be the shrine when the Prophet Muhammad try tucked, also called Hujra al-Muattara (The Fragrant Room) or Hujra al-Saadah (The Blessed area). The Prophet died within the room of his own wife, Aisha, whom he cherished much. He had been buried below since he stated, “Prophets are generally buried where the two die.”

Aisha experienced his daddy, the main caliph Abu Bakr, hidden in this article when he expired. Until the second caliph Umar died, the guy expected Aisha for consent for hidden here. She offered consent by stating, “I prefer Umar to me personally.”

Whenever Umar got hidden, she drew a curtain behind the graves and lived in this area until the lady death in 678 (May Allah be pleased with all of them). When this hoe expired, she would never feel buried here, like the latest location within the room is definitely reserved for Prophet Jesus (Prophet Isa), who can descend to your planet within the Qiyamah (the time of Resurrection). The reason is , the Prophet Muhammad mentioned that when Jesus Christ expires after coming to earth, however feel tucked alongside himself. This exclaiming takes place in as-Sunan al-Tirmidhi and Sunan al-Darimi.

A mud-brick area with a solid wood limit, Aisha lived-in a 3-meter (9.8-foot) highest place, made of adobe. The roof would be dealt with with hand divisions. They received two gates, one about western as well various other of the north. The western gate https://www.besthookupwebsites.org/polyamorous-dating/ popped to the side of Rawda al-Mutahhara (Clean landscaping), the masjid belonging to the Prophet Muhammad.

When caliph Umar would be expanding the Al-Masjid al-Nabawi in 638, the guy made a stone-wall around Hujra al-Saadah.

Caliph Abd Allah ibn al-Zubayr, exactly who expired in 692, demolished this wall structure around his cousin Aisha’s space and reconstructed it with black colored rock. This walla€™s threshold would be open and yes it have a door throughout the north area. Whenever Hasan ibn-ali, the grandson belonging to the prophet, died in 669, his friend Husayn, based on his will, brought the funeral (since it is done right in EyA?p Sultan tomb in Istanbul) around the Hujra al-Saadah’s gate to hope with all the boon of prophet.

During that time, there had been individuals that believed they might conceal one’s body right here and couldn’t desire him as earned. In order to avoid any disturbance, it was not contributed within it. As soon as the prayer, he had been buried inside the popular cemetery of Medina, Jannat al-Baqi. In order to really prevent this type of reports in the foreseeable future, this doorway of walls together with the space were walled-up and sealed.

Whenever Umayyad Caliph Walid would be the governor of Medina, he raised the wall structure beyond your grave and secure it with a tiny attic. The 3 tombs cannot be seen from your external and cannot become inserted.

While Umar trash Abd al-Aziz was actually the governor of Medina, in 706, while broadening the Al-Masjid al-Nabawi because of the order of caliph Walid, an alternate wall surface ended up being developed across grave. This structure is pentagonal.

Jamal al-Din al-Isfahani, Salahaddin al-Ayyubi’s relative and Zangi’s vizier, got a railing (shabaka) composeded of sandalwood and african american foliage across the exterior wall of Hujra al-Saadah in 1188. The barrier would be the elevation of threshold on the mosque. A white silk curtain (sattara) on which the chapter of Surah al-Yasin ended up being printed in red silk, delivered from Egypt that spring, had been hung during railing.

Nevertheless railing afterwards used in a fire. In 1289, the railing was made of iron and coloured eco-friendly. This barrier is known as Shabaka al-Saadah. The qibla half is known as Muwacaha al-Saadah, the eastern area known as Kadam al-Saadah, the american area known as Rawda al-Mutahhara, and northern back are Hujra al-Fatima.

Correct, in the exact middle of the Al-Masjid al-Nabawi, that’s, into the Rawda al-Mutahhara, the portion of the mosque in time of the prophet, you have the Hujra al-Saadah the left region of the guy facing the qibla, as well pulpit of what the prophet provided his own sermon on his proper neck. The grave associated with prophet is often seen from away from the railing.
